diff options
author | Skip Montanaro <skip@pobox.com> | 2008-11-19 03:35:41 (GMT) |
---|---|---|
committer | Skip Montanaro <skip@pobox.com> | 2008-11-19 03:35:41 (GMT) |
commit | 7fb29797e3b53fdb73155d269f210a3da7d725d6 (patch) | |
tree | 79de4d1c55b28a8be999b26d991771c71e431aef /Lib | |
parent | 7cfe7ea745d6222103c32c089e591229de2c2817 (diff) | |
download | cpython-7fb29797e3b53fdb73155d269f210a3da7d725d6.zip cpython-7fb29797e3b53fdb73155d269f210a3da7d725d6.tar.gz cpython-7fb29797e3b53fdb73155d269f210a3da7d725d6.tar.bz2 |
patch from issue 1108
Diffstat (limited to 'Lib')
-rw-r--r-- | Lib/doctest.py |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/Lib/doctest.py b/Lib/doctest.py index 8806d6e..8a5a22c 100644 --- a/Lib/doctest.py +++ b/Lib/doctest.py @@ -854,12 +854,12 @@ class DocTestFinder: """ if module is None: return True + elif inspect.getmodule(object) is not None: + return module is inspect.getmodule(object) elif inspect.isfunction(object): return module.__dict__ is object.func_globals elif inspect.isclass(object): return module.__name__ == object.__module__ - elif inspect.getmodule(object) is not None: - return module is inspect.getmodule(object) elif hasattr(object, '__module__'): return module.__name__ == object.__module__ elif isinstance(object, property): |